- fix: trust new notebooks and notebooks with new cells #275 (@maartenbreddels)
- Fix ci end-to-end tests #274 (@maartenbreddels)
- Fix
Linux JS Test
CI job #269 (@krassowski) - Update dependency requirements to minimum necessary #259 (@RRosio)
- Adding pydata_sphinx_theme to environment.yml file for docs build #262 (@RRosio)
- Fix links for check_release links CI job #260 (@RRosio)
- Port to PyData-Sphinx Theme #256 (@RRosio)
(GitHub contributors page for this release)
@jph00 | @krassowski | @maartenbreddels | @RRosio
(GitHub contributors page for this release)
- Updated main page README. #246 (@ericsnekbytes)
- Use the correct icon to display the application #245 (@befeleme)
- State the correct name of the application in the desktop entry #244 (@befeleme)
(GitHub contributors page for this release)
@befeleme | @echarles | @ericsnekbytes
(GitHub contributors page for this release)
@echarles | @matthew-brett | @mwouts
- Copy marked.umd.js to marked.js and revert loading #236 (@echarles)
- CI Test Fixed Round6a #234 (@ericsnekbytes)
- CI Test Fixes Round 5 #232 (@ericsnekbytes)
- CI Test Fixed Round6a #234 (@ericsnekbytes)
- CI Test Fixes Round 5 #232 (@ericsnekbytes)
(GitHub contributors page for this release)
- Fix generating of .mo and .json files for nl translation #221 (@frenzymadness)
- Fix banner icons #220 (@echarles)
- CI Test Fixes Round 4 #226 (@ericsnekbytes)
(GitHub contributors page for this release)
@echarles | @ericsnekbytes | @frenzymadness | @RRosio
- CI Test Fixes Round 3 #216 (@ericsnekbytes)
- CI Test Fixes Round 2 #212 (@ericsnekbytes)
- Update get_rendered_contents further marked javascript upgrade #210 (@echarles)
- CI Test Fixes Round 3 #216 (@ericsnekbytes)
- CI Test Fixes Round 2 #212 (@ericsnekbytes)
(GitHub contributors page for this release)
@echarles | @ellisonbg | @ericsnekbytes | @hroncok | @RRosio
- Add packages and package_data back in the setup_args #206 (@echarles)
- Add static and templates as artifact for hatch build #205 (@echarles)
(GitHub contributors page for this release)
- Ci test fixes round1 #202 (@ericsnekbytes)
- fix loading of static and template path config #192 (@minrk)
- Add pytest_jupyter to the list of test deps #190 (@echarles)
- Align setup.py and setup.cfg #181 (@echarles)
- Ci test fixes round1 #202 (@ericsnekbytes)
- Remove duplicate notebook_shim from setup.cfg #197 (@frenzymadness)
- Upgrade moment javascript package #186 (@echarles)
- Add dependabot config #175 (@blink1073)
- Fix the jupyter server base.handlers import #187 (@echarles)
- Revert pull request 168 #184 (@echarles)
(GitHub contributors page for this release)
@blink1073 | @echarles | @ericsnekbytes | @frenzymadness | @jtpio | @kevin-bates | @minrk | @RRosio
- Playwright Testing Conversion #170 (@ericsnekbytes)
- Handle async and sync contents managers #172 (@blink1073)
- Playwright port #139 (@ericsnekbytes)
- Documentation for the extensions configurator #174 (@echarles)
- Updating contributing docs for playwright tests #171 (@RRosio)
(GitHub contributors page for this release)
@blink1073 | @dleen | @echarles | @ericsnekbytes | @RRosio
- Add a redirect from /nbclassic to /nbclassic/tree if both notebook>=7 if both notebook>=7 and nbclassic are installed #166 (@echarles)
(GitHub contributors page for this release)
- Adds new file custom-preload that is loaded in a different order than custom.js before the main.js script is executed #155 (@lneves12)
(GitHub contributors page for this release)
@echarles | @lneves12 | @RRosio
(GitHub contributors page for this release)
- Stop looking in the old IPython directory for nbextensions #153 (@minrk)
- Handlers under nbclassic if notebook 7 is found #141 (@echarles)
- Fix resource display when redirecting from /notebooks/* #148 (@echarles)
- Rename duplicate entrypoints #138 (@echarles)
- Point nbclassic at the classic jupyter_notebook_config path #137 (@Zsailer)
- Updating JS Dependencies #152 (@RRosio)
- Get the notebook version from notebook._version #133 (@echarles)
(GitHub contributors page for this release)
@echarles | @jtpio | @minrk | @RRosio | @Zsailer
- Handle execution errors with empty traceback entries similar to Lab #126 (@kevin-bates)
- Fix handling of dev version when releasing #131 (@echarles)
- Update release notes for 0.4.2 #125 (@echarles)
(GitHub contributors page for this release)
@echarles | @kevin-bates | @minrk
- Fix executable name in desktop file #119 (@antonio-rojas)
(GitHub contributors page for this release)
This release has been skipped by the release process.
- Shim to support the notebook extensions #113 (@echarles)
- Fix
Check Release / check_release
CI job #102 (@echarles) - nbclassic to use its own static assets #96 (@echarles)
- [HOT FIX] Test Selenium CI #114 (@echarles)
- Fix
link_check
CI Job #111 (@echarles) - Fix
downstream
CI Job #110 (@echarles) - Disable
Test Minimum Version
CI Job #109 (@echarles) - Fix
Make SDist
CI Job by installing babel as a build dependency #108 (@RRosio) - Exclude Services tests from
Linux JS Tests
Job and Separate Workflow for flaky Selenium Tests #105 (@RRosio) - CI fix for "Testing nbclassic" on macos 3.7, 3.8, 3.9, 3.10 #104 (@ericsnekbytes)
- Fix part of the
Linux JS Tests
/ Notebook and Base Test Failures in CI Job #103 (@RRosio)
- Add the notebook 6.4.x tests, docs and companion files (with git history) #94 (@echarles)
- Add the notebook static assets (with git history) #93 (@echarles)
- Add post-version-spec in tool.jupyer-releaser.options #116 (@echarles)
- CI fix for "Testing nbclassic" on macos / pypy #106 (@ericsnekbytes)
- [CI] Fix the
Docs Tests
job #99 (@echarles)
(GitHub contributors page for this release)
@blink1073 | @echarles | @ericsnekbytes | @RRosio | @Zsailer
- Clean up packaging and CI #91 (@blink1073)
(GitHub contributors page for this release)
(GitHub contributors page for this release)
- Clean up downstream tests #82 (@blink1073)
- Enforce labels on PRs #80 (@blink1073)
(GitHub contributors page for this release)
(GitHub contributors page for this release)
- add missing lines to manifest #72 (@Zsailer)
- add changelog comments for jupyter-releaser #70 (@Zsailer)
- add setup.py back to enable jupyter_releaser #69 (@Zsailer)
- Add workflow to test JupyterLab #67 (@Zsailer)
- Expose classic notebook's static assets from their original endpoints #63 (@Zsailer)
(GitHub contributors page for this release)
- ExtensionManager's link_extension changed call signature #64 (@athornton)
- Fix link to the Jupyter Notebook repo in README #62 (@saiwing-yeung)
(GitHub contributors page for this release)
@athornton | @saiwing-yeung | @welcome
(GitHub contributors page for this release)
- Support creating terminal with a given name. #52 (@cailiang9)
- BUG fix: correct redirection to {base_url}/edit/*. #55 (@cailiang9)
(GitHub contributors page for this release)
@cailiang9 | @welcome | @Zsailer
- Remove forced sorting of extensions #49 (@minrk)
- Add Changelog #48 (@blink1073)
(GitHub contributors page for this release)
@blink1073 | @minrk | @welcome
- Fix deprecation warning when importing jupyter_server.transutils._ #47 (@martinRenou)
- Add a redirect handler to open non-notebook files from the cli #45 (@jtpio)
- Add default_url trait to NotebookApp #42 (@afshin)
- Fix GitHub Actions badge #40 (@jtpio)
- Run jupyter nbclassic -h on CI #29 (@jtpio)
(GitHub contributors page for this release)
@afshin | @blink1073 | @jtpio | @martinRenou | @welcome | @Zsailer
(GitHub contributors page for this release)
(GitHub contributors page for this release)
- Exclude tests from dist #36 (@bollwyvl)
- Update release instructions #34 (@jasongrout)
(GitHub contributors page for this release)
@bollwyvl | @jasongrout | @Zsailer
- Moves terminal websocket handling back to Jupyter Server #33 (@jasongrout)
(GitHub contributors page for this release)
(GitHub contributors page for this release)